Bendy's height is nearly about the size of Henry.īendy first appears as numerous cardboard cutouts throughout the Workshop. His black hair forms with two sharp-edged shapes similar to horns.Īs seen from the entire first chapter, he only appear being made out of card-boards. He wear black shoes, a white bowtie, and a pair of gloves closely resemble to Mickey Mouse's. His cheerful-looking expression sport a wide grin and Pac-Man styled eyes. From in-game, he is also the main antagonist in Bendy and the Ink Machine, first appearing in Chapter 1.īendy is a devil-based cartoon character with, like other cartoon characters, his only two colors are black and white.
